James J. Tucci, M.D.

170 W. 12th St., Spellman 7
New York, NY 10011
212-604-6267  

Pediatric Orthopaedic Surgery

Dr. Tucci is board certified by the American Board of Orthopaedic Surgery, a fellow of the American Academy of Orthopaedic Surgeons, and a member of the Pediatric Orthopaedic Society of North America. He has published articles in the Journal of Sports Medicine, Orthopedics and the Journal of Pediatric Orthopaedics and has presented to peer groups throughout the country.

Dr. Tucci earned his medical degree from Downstate Medical Center of the State University of New York (SUNY), and completed residency-training programs in both surgery and orthopaedic surgery at St. Vincent's Hospital Manhattan. He subsequently completed a fellowship in pediatric orthopaedic surgery at the Alfred I. Dupont Institute in Wilmington, Delaware. He has been an attending pediatric orthopaedic surgeon affiliated with many area medical centers, including SUNY Downstate, Brookdale, Kings County, Kingsbrook and Beth Israel Medical Center.

Dr. Tucci specializes in pediatric orthopaedic surgery, with a special focus on scoliosis, clubfeet, children's fracture care and correction of deformities.
